◆ About iDICE programme
The iDICE programme is a Federal Government of Nigeria initiative implemented by the Bank of Industry to promote innovation, entrepreneurship, and job creation in the digital, information technology, and creative industries through catalytic investments and capacity building.[1][3] It provides equity/quasi-equity funding via DICE Funds and non-equity grants/training through programs like Startup Bridge's Founders Lab and Growth Lab, targeting early-stage tech-enabled startups.[1][2][4] Supported by AfDB, AFD, and IsDB with $617.7 million, it aims to upskill youth aged 15-35 and bridge financing gaps in these sectors.[3][4]

◆ FAQ
What does iDICE invest in?
iDICE invests in Creator Economy, Streaming & Media, Enterprise Software and Consumer Apps at the pre-seed and seed stages.
Which geographies does iDICE focus on?
iDICE focuses on Nigeria, and is headquartered in Nigeria.
